Distant + pouring with rain, but I think thereβs just enough to i.d this as Angleseyβs second Caspian Gull. Dark tertials, long gangly legs (especially tibia), thin black bill + white rounded head, size. It also showed a nice black tail band + white auxiliaries when it flew #birdingwales #ukbirding
